Understanding the Mechanism of Rybelsus and Levothyroxine
To optimize the benefits of taking levothyroxine and Rybelsus, understanding their mechanisms is crucial. Levothyroxine acts as a synthetic form of the thyroid hormone thyroxine (T4), which regulates metabolism, energy levels, and overall bodily functions. It absorbs best on an empty stomach, enhancing its effectiveness in managing hypothyroidism.
Rybelsus, on the other hand, is a GLP-1 receptor agonist that aids in blood sugar control for individuals with type 2 diabetes. It works by stimulating insulin secretion in response to meals, slowing gastric emptying, and reducing appetite. This mechanism helps in weight management and glucose regulation.
